  • VPN, wireguard, blocking, chrome. I had a similar case and a perfect solution proved to be Apache Guacamole (https://guacamole.incubator.apache.org/). Absolutely clientless RDP/SSH access to any server with any common browser (HTML5). Works as a proxy for RDP/SSH (magic) Simple install on Ubuntu via https://github.com/MysticRyuujin/guac-install and an extra Nginx (see bottom of readme). Who needs OpenVPN anymore - I bet it cannot be locked down as long as you have the ubuntu public IP allowed.
